21710175538 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 32566533660. Its totient is φ = 10854664320.
The previous prime is 21710175467. The next prime is 21710175541. The reversal of 21710175538 is 83557101712.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 21613998289 + 96177249 = 147017^2 + 9807^2 .
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 21710175538.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 143203 + ... + 252838.
Almost surely, 221710175538 is an apocalyptic number.
21710175538 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(10856358122).
21710175538 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
21710175538 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 423452.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 58800, while the sum is 40.
